The global Handheld Narcotics Analyzer market size is expected to reach $ 375 million by 2032, rising at a market growth of 4.5% CAGR during the forecast period (2026-2032).
In 2024, global Handheld Narcotics Analyzer production capacity is 20,000 units, with production volume reached approximately 13,000 units, with an average global market price of around US$ 21,000 per unit. The market gross margin is mainly 30%-40%.
A handheld narcotics analyzer is a portable imaging and spectroscopic detection device that utilizes analytical techniques such as Raman spectroscopy, FT-IR, ion mobility spectrometry (IMS), micro-mass spectrometry, or fluorescence colorimetry to rapidly, on-site, non-destructively, or trace-level detect cocaine, heroin, methamphetamine, fentanyl, new psychoactive substances (NPS), and mixtures. Its core features include high sensitivity, rapid qualitative identification, detection even in packaged form, automatic comparison with spectral libraries, and the ability to resolve unknown substances. It also enables real-time, "on-site testing" pre-screening in law enforcement, border checks, customs security, airports, ports, prisons, drug rehabilitation facilities, and emergency response sites, making it a crucial on-site detection terminal in modern drug enforcement equipment systems.
The handheld drug detection device industry chain consists of "core components → spectral system → complete device manufacturing → software and database → application scenarios": the upstream includes lasers, spectral detectors (CCD/CMOS/InGaAs), optical components, interferometers, ion migration tubes, miniature vacuum pumps, embedded processors, batteries, and ruggedized body materials; the midstream involves complete device manufacturers designing spectral modules, developing algorithms, building spectral libraries, system integration, calibration, and reliability testing; the downstream covers law enforcement, narcotics control departments, customs and border control, airport and port security, prisons and drug rehabilitation centers, emergency and hazardous chemical response agencies, and forms a demand chain through government procurement, security equipment integrators, and international security inspection projects. With the diversification of illicit drug structures, the increase in NPS, the upgrading of cross-border drug smuggling, and the increase in security budgets in various countries, the industry chain is accelerating its development towards high sensitivity, broad-spectrum spectral libraries, AI recognition, and multi-technology integration (Raman + IMS + MS).
Handheld Narcotics Analyzers exhibit strong and long-term market growth potential globally. The core drivers are the highly diversified forms of drugs, the proliferation of fentanyl-type ultra-lethal drugs, the rapid mutation of new psychoactive substances (NPS), and the globalization of cross-border drug smuggling routes. Traditional reagent kits are no longer sufficient to meet law enforcement's needs for rapid, non-destructive, accurate, and on-site pre-screening. With the accelerated advancement of portable and intelligent technologies such as Raman spectroscopy, FT-IR, IMS, and miniature mass spectrometry, handheld analyzers are becoming standard equipment for customs, police, border control, airports, ports, prison systems, and anti-narcotics departments, receiving continuous budgetary investment. Meanwhile, the high public safety pressure posed by fentanyl and its precursor chemicals in North America is driving large-scale equipment upgrades in the United States and Canada. Europe, due to the increase in synthetic drug laboratories and cross-border trafficking, is also strengthening frontline law enforcement equipment upgrades. Emerging markets in the Asia-Pacific, Latin America, and the Middle East are entering a phase of accelerated equipment procurement due to increased cross-border logistics and stricter local compliance requirements. On the technology front, innovations such as AI spectral recognition, cloud-based spectral library updates, mixture deconvolution, and multi-technology fusion (Raman+IMS) are continuously improving equipment performance, transforming the product from an "auxiliary tool" into a "primary detection method," and significantly increasing its unit price and market penetration. Overall, driven by the long-term rigid demand for drug control, the digital upgrade of law enforcement equipment, increased government security investment, and the gradual decline in technology costs, handheld drug testing devices will maintain steady growth in the coming years.
